Red Bank Regional was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their seventh straight defeat. They came up short against the Lakewood Piners, falling 3-0.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Bucs of the 2-0 loss they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in September of 2018.
The match finished with set scores of 25-20, 25-20, 25-13.
Red Bank Regional's defeat dropped their record down to 3-13. As for Lakewood, their victory ended a four-match drought on the road dating back to last season and puts them at 2-3.
Red Bank Regional did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 2-1 loss against Long Branch on the 24th. Lakewood has also already played their next matchup (against New Brunswick),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ing.
